2007-12-05Update sudo package to 1.6.9p9.taca2-6/+6
Major changes since Sudo 1.6.9p8: o The ALL command in sudoers now implies SETENV permissions. o The command search is now performed using the target user's auxiliary group vector, not just the target's primary group. o When determining if the PAM prompt is the default "Password: ", compare the localized version if possible. o New passprompt_override option in sudoers to cause sudo's prompt to be used in all cases. Also set when the -p flag is used.

2007-11-11Update to 2.0.3:wiz3-8/+11
* Version 2.0.3 (released 2007-11-10) ** This version backports several fixes from the 2.1.x branch. ** Fixed PKCS #3 parameter export. ** Added gnutls_record_disable_padding() to allow servers talking to buggy clients that complain if the TLS 1.0 record protocol padding is used. ** Introduced gnutls_session_enable_compatibility_mode() to allow enabling all supported compatibility options (like disabling padding). ** Corrected bug which did not allow a server to run without supporting certificates. ** API and ABI modifications: gnutls_session_enable_compatibility_mode: ADDED gnutls_record_disable_padding: ADDED Add LICENSE, commented out; it contains both LGPL-2.1 and GPL2 code.

2007-11-07Update to 2.0.7. This is maintenance release with a few minor enhancements.shannonjr4-20/+21
Changes: * Fixed encryption problem if duplicate certificates are in the keybox. * Add new options min-passphrase-nonalpha, check-passphrase-pattern, enforce-passphrase-constraints and max-passphrase-days to gpg-agent. * Add command --check-components to gpgconf. Gpgconf now uses the installed versions of the programs and does not anymore search via PATH for them.
